Total Cost of Ownership: CapEx vs. OpEx

Legacy MFT solutions typically follow a CapEx (capital expenditure) model. You pay for maximum capacity up front – including hardware procurement, maintenance, seat licenses, and idle bandwidth.

The MASV MFT model (OpEx): We align with your project cash flow. You don’t pay for software you aren’t using.

  • Pay-as-you-go: No subscription required. Ideal for fluctuating project work.
  • Value plans: High-volume users can lock in discounts via pre-buy credits or monthly subscriptions.
  • Custom enterprise plans: Tailored solutions for global organizations needing predictable billing.

The Speed Myth: Why You Don’t Need UDP Anymore

For two decades, UDP was the only way to send large files fast – but it came with failed transfers and configuration headaches. MASV web-based transfer leverages a global edge network of 400-plus servers combined with bandwidth optimization, allowing UDP-equivalent speeds (10Gbps+) without all the bad stuff, like catastrophic packet loss.

  • Firewall friendly: Uses standard port 443. No IT intervention required.
  • Global performance: Your package never travels far before it’s riding our global accelerated network of 400-plus servers.
  • Bandwidth saturation: MASV uses up to 95% of your available bandwidth, without being a network bully.
  • Network bonding: Our free Desktop App bonds multiple internet connections for increased speed and reliability.
  • Relentless reliability: If a transfer is interrupted, MASV auto-resumes exactly where it left off.

What is a managed file transfer (MFT) solution?

Managed file transfer (MFT) is enterprise software that secures and automates data exchange. However, not all MFTs are the same. Legacy MFTs (like Aspera, Signiant, or GoAnywhere) are server-based solutions that require hardware maintenance and IT management. Modern MFTs (like MASV) are cloud native, offering superior security and automation without the need to procure and set up servers, install software, manage updates, or configure complex firewalls.

How much does an MFT solution cost?

Cost is the biggest differentiator. Legacy MFT solutions typically use a CapEx model, requiring upfront  license and hardware purchases ($5,000–$50,000+), annual maintenance fees, eventual hardware upgrades, and costs for idle bandwidth. MASV disrupts this with a flexible OpEx model, where you pay $0 for software and infrastructure and can use the pricing model that works best for you (pay-as-you-go, pre-buys, subscriptions, or enterprise custom pricing).

What industries use MFT software?

MFT is essential for industries moving sensitive, high-value, or massive data sets. The primary users are media & entertainment and post-production (for raw footage and DCPs), geospatial (for GIS and aerial datasets), live broadcast and news (for gameday footage and deadline-driven reporter content), creative agencies (for marketing content), healthcare (for patient records/HIPAA compliance), and legal (for eDiscovery).

Do I need to open firewall ports for MASV like I do for UDP?

No. This is a massive security advantage of MASV: Legacy MFTs often require opening UDP port 33001 (or a range of high-number ports), which creates a permanent expanded attack surface on your network. MASV tunnels high-speed traffic through standard TCP port 443 (HTTPS). This means you get 10Gbps speeds without asking your CISO to compromise network security.

Why is FTP no longer used?

FTP sends credentials in plain text, making it a security risk. It’s also an outdated technology with a primitive user interface that can be extremely challenging for inexperienced users. While legacy MFT replaced FTP with proprietary UDP protocols (which introduced new firewall headaches), MASV replaces FTP and legacy MFT with accelerated web-based transfer offering the security of HTTPS, the speed of UDP, and the ease of use of drag-and-drop without the vulnerability of open ports that FTP or legacy UDP solutions require.
